Analysis
The most recent figure for getting credit: strength of legal rights index (0-10) in Czechia is 6 DB05-14 methodology, measured in 2013. That is the lowest value across all 10 years on record.
The figure is down 14.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, getting credit: strength of legal rights index (0-10) in Czechia peaked at 7 DB05-14 methodology in 2004 and was at its lowest, 6 DB05-14 methodology, in 2008.
Czechia ranks 76th of 184 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

About this data
The strength of legal rights index measures whether certain features that facilitate lending exist within the applicable collateral and bankruptcy laws. The index ranges from 0 to 10 based on the methodology in the DB05-14 studies.
